About Kingsgrove 2208

The size of Kingsgrove is approximately 4.5 square kilometres. It has 22 parks covering nearly 7.6% of total area. The population of Kingsgrove in 2011 was 11,515 people. By 2016 the population was 12,433 showing a population growth of 8.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Kingsgrove is 40-49 years. Households in Kingsgrove are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Kingsgrove work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 73.5% of the homes in Kingsgrove were owner-occupied compared with 71.8% in 2016.

Kingsgrove has 6,021 properties.
